摘要:In this report, we will study the implementation ofphotovoltaic fed Dynamic Voltage Restorer (PVDVR)that can be used to maintain the voltage level during poor voltage quality conditions and also can be used tomaintain power on a low voltage residential supply arrangement for the duration of both day time and night time.During excess voltage regulation, the PV-DVR reduce the power saving from the utility grid by disconnecting theutility grid from the load As the Photovoltaic arrangement generates average power to the required critical load throughthe day time. Many research has insisted on using a low step-up DC–DC converter, but the use of an interleaved highstep up DC-DC converter with PI controller algorithm can get rid of the drawback of conventional PV based DVR bytracking disorder & detect maximum power point (MPPT) of the photo voltaic array. The positive results are validatedusing Simulation results
